  • Abstract
    A scalable authentication protocol is proposed for security and efficient RFID communication. The performance evaluation and security analysis has proved its advantages. Compared with other protocols, it can preserve content and location privacy, resist replay attacks and Dos attacks, and has forward security and scalable.
